![]() 15 Proprietary & Confidential Information EverDrive: Social Safe-Driving Mobile App Uses smartphone sensors and telematics to assess driving performance Provides drivers with actionable feedback on becoming a safer driver Social features enable positive competition with family and friends |
![]() 16 Proprietary & Confidential Information EverDrive Seamlessly Connects Drivers with Savings Users opt-in to anonymously receive safe driving offers Seamless integrations connect them to carriers for purchase Policy details and consumer relationship remain within EverDrive experience Launched with first carrier in September 2018, expanded to 12 states in 1Q2019 and 24 states in 2Q2019 Carrier Partner #1 Contact Carrier #1 |

![]() 22 Proprietary & Confidential Information Note: Adjusted EBITDA is a non-GAAP metrics, refer to financial reconciliation for additional detail
First Quarter 2019 Highlights
Revenue increased 28%
year-over-year to $52.2 Million GAAP Net Loss
of $4.4 Million
Adjusted EBITDA of $(1.3)
Million Increased Full Year 2019 Revenue, VMM
& Adjusted EBITDA Guidance
Variable Marketing Margin (VMM)
increased 25%
year-over-year to $13.9 Million 7 of the Companys top 10
providers expanded spend over the prior year EverQuote added 6 new and 14 expanded partial technology integrations with providers |

![]() 26 Proprietary & Confidential Information Key Metrics Definitions Metric Definition Quote Requests Quote requests are consumer-submitted website forms that contain the data required to provide an
insurance quote, quote requests we receive through offline channels such as telephone
calls, quote requests via our EverDrive
app, and quote requests submitted directly to third-party partners. As we
attract more consumers to our platform and they complete quote requests,
we are able to refer them to our insurance provider customers, selling
more referrals while also collecting data, which we use to improve user
experience, conversion rates and consumer satisfaction. Variable Marketing
Margin Beginning in the first quarter of 2019, we revised our definition of variable marketing margin, or VMM, as
revenue, as reported in our statements of operations and comprehensive loss, less
advertising costs (a component of sales and marketing expense, as
reported in our statements of operations and comprehensive loss). We use
VMM to measure the efficiency of individual advertising and consumer
acquisition sources and to make trade-off decisions to manage our return on
advertising. Under our previous definition of VMM, our VMM for the three
months ended March 31, 2018 was $11.7 million as advertising costs used
in our previously defined VMM calculation excluded advertising costs related to our EverDrive app and advertising costs not related to obtaining quote requests. Adjusted EBITDA We define adjusted EBITDA as net loss, adjusted to exclude: stock-based compensation expense,
depreciation and amortization expense, interest expense and the provision for (benefit
from) income taxes. We monitor and
present adjusted EBITDA because it is a key measure used by our management
and board of directors to understand and evaluate our operating
performance, to establish budgets and to develop operational goals for
managing our business. |
